2.6-Magnitude Earthquake Hits San Fernando

SAN FERNANDO (CBSLA.com) — A 2.6-magnitude earthquake shook the San Fernando Valley Tuesday.

The tremor hit at 4:57 a.m. and was epicentered two miles southeast of San Fernando, the U.S. Geological Survey said.

There were no reported of damage or injuries.
